Bill Summary
Demanding Congress call a Convention of States to propose amendments to the Constitution of the United States to establish the United States Supreme Court as nine Justices.
AI Summary
This resolution, originating from the West Virginia Legislature, calls upon the United States Congress to fulfill its constitutional duty under Article V of the U.S. Constitution by convening a Convention of States. This convention would be tasked with proposing amendments to the Constitution, specifically to establish a fixed number of nine Justices for the United States Supreme Court, as the current Constitution does not specify this number. The resolution also directs that copies be sent to various federal officials and state legislative leaders to encourage their participation in this process.
